Sainsbury's

The online grocery shopping service is an excellent way to stock up on daily food essentials. You can choose the day and time that you want to receive your groceries. There are options for all budgets regardless of whether you're looking for a single item or a weekly shopping spree.

In 1869, the company was founded. Sainsbury's is the second largest chain of supermarkets in the UK and has a 16 per cent share of the market. It offers a wide range of goods, including food, clothing and household items. It also provides banking services through Sainsbury's Bank, and operates the Argos chain of retail stores. Its head office is located in Holborn, London.

In recent years, the retailer has expanded its online offerings. In 2015, the retailer introduced an app for mobile devices to enhance customer experience and increase the capacity of delivery. Sainsbury's also offers same-day delivery in selected areas. At present, the company provides delivery to more than 40 million homes and businesses across the UK.

In order to compete with German discounters such as Aldi and Lidl, Sainsbury's has been increasing its investment in its own brand of products. Sainsbury's has cut prices on its most popular products and offered price matching on certain products. This strategy has proved successful in driving sales growth for Sainsbury's which has exceeded the sales of Tesco and Asda.

Sainsbury's offers a wide range of products, including its own brand along with brand names and organic and free-from foods. The store also has a great selection of wine and spirits. There are also a variety of convenience stores in England, Wales, and Scotland.

Sainsbury's has a reputation for its high-quality food items and beverages. It is one of the UK's largest online grocery stores. Its fresh produce is usually more pristine than that of its rivals, and its own-brand products are usually priced lower. The delivery times can be a bit disappointing. According to a study by consumer group Which? researchers, Sainsbury's grocery store had the lowest amount of time until their expiration dates.

ASDA

You can save money by ordering your groceries online. Each supermarket has its own peak and off-peak hours however, you'll typically get a better deal by ordering on weekdays and avoiding weekends and evenings. Sign up for a grocery's delivery pass to save money. These passes will usually give you free delivery for up to a year. Additionally, they may offer exclusive deals and discounts.

ASDA recently became the most affordable online retailer in the UK, according to research by the price-tracking website Alertr. The site analyzed 42 items found in a typical shopping cart, including milk and bread eggs, rice, pasta cereal, as well as other items. It discovered that ASDA was nearly PS7 cheaper than Tesco for the basket, which comprised brand-name and own-brand items. Other supermarkets in the top five included Morrisons, Waitrose and Ocado. The results were based solely on the prices of a week's shopping and excluded Aldi and Lidl.

The Co-op

Online grocery shopping is very popular in the UK. The best supermarkets in the country offer cheap prices and free delivery for purchases of PS25 or more. You can also shop at ethnic supermarkets that offer various international cuisines. In addition there are numerous bars and food markets in every town and city.

Online shopping for groceries could save you money and time, especially if your supermarket is far away. It is important to check the local delivery fees before making a purchase. If you're looking for the best value make sure to shop during times of reduced prices at the supermarket. At these times, you'll get great discounts on items that are close to their expiration date.

The Co-op is a UK-based co-operative retailer that has partnered with Uber Eats to provide a delivery service for its members. The partnership is expected to boost the Co-op's membership numbers from five million to eight million by 2030. Alongside the partnership with Uber, Co-op has revamped its membership offerings and introduced a new round of Member Price. This includes 117 low everyday prices applied within its food business for members, including brand-name products for the first time.
